Patient Services Coordinator

4 months ago


Anniston, United States NYU Winthrop Full time

Compassionate care, uncompromising service and clinical excellence – that’s what our patients have come to expect from our clinicians. Kindred at Home, a division of Kindred Healthcare Inc., is the nation’s leading provider of comprehensive home health, hospice, and non-medical home care services.

Kindred at Home, and its affiliates,delivers compassionate, high-quality care to patients and clients in their homes or places of residence, including non-medical personal assistance, skilled nursing and rehabilitation and hospice and palliative care. Our caregivers focus on each unique patient to deliver the appropriate care and emotional support to our patients and their families.

The PATIENT SERVICES COORDINATOR is directly responsible for scheduling visits and communicating with field staff, patients, physicians, etc. to maintain proper care coordination and continuity of care. The role also assists with day-to-day office and staff management

Manages schedules for all patients. Edits schedule for agents calling in sick, ensuring patients are reassigned timely. Updates agent unavailability in worker console.

Initiates infection control forms as needed, sends the HRD the completed “Employee Infection Report” to upload in the worker console.

Serves as back up during the lunch hour and other busy times including receiving calls from the field staff and assisting with weekly case conferences. Refers clinical questions to Branch Director as necessary.

Maintains the client hospitalization log, including entering coordination notes, and sending electronic log to all office, field, and sales staff.

Completes requested schedule as task appears on the action screen. Ensures staff are scheduled for skilled nurse/injection visits unless an aide supervisory visit is scheduled in conjunction with the injection visit.

Completes requested schedules for all add-ons and applicable orders:

Schedules discharge visit / OASIS Collection or recert visit following case conference when task appears on action screen.

Schedules TIF OASIS collection visits and deletes remaining schedule.

Reschedules declined or missed (if appropriate) visits.

Processes reassigned and rescheduled visits.

Ensures supervisory visits are scheduled.

Runs all scheduling reports including Agent Summary Report and Missed Visits Done on Paper Report.

Prepares weekly Agent Schedules. Performs initial review of weekly schedule for productivity / geographic issues and forwards schedule to Branch Director for approval prior to distribution to staff.

Verifies visit paper notes in scheduling console as needed.

Assists with internal transfer of patients between branch offices.

If clinical, receives lab reports and assesses for normality, fax a copy of lab to doctor, make a copy for the Case Manager, and route to Medical Records Department. Initiate Employee / Patient Infection Reports as necessary.

If clinical, may be required to perform patient visits and / or participate in on-call rotation.

Required Skills

Be a Licensed Professional Nurse or a Licensed Vocational Nurse licensed in the state in which he / she practices OR have at least 1 year of home health experience.

Prior packet review / QI experience preferred.

Coding certification is preferred.

Must possess a valid state driver’s license and automobile liability insurance.

Must be currently licensed in the State of employment if applicable.

Must possess excellent communication skills, the ability to interact well with a diverse group of individuals, strong organizational skills, and the ability to manage and prioritize multiple assignments.
